I am very proud! The Phenotypic Evolution Time Series (PETS) database is now online! pets.nhm.uio.no PETS is a public database containing data on phenotypic change within (fossil and contemporary) lineages. Why did we make it? A short 🧵

Things that Darwin hated, a 🧵 To Charles Lyell, 1st Oct 1861 But I am very poorly today & very stupid & hate everybody & everything. One lives only to make blunders.— I am going to write a little Book for Murray on orchids & today I hate them worse than everything
